Transaction 51c3a91e679abf649b9a19449d4d46c743d97ea2273d840118f82bc840be2020
1 Input
1 Output
-
51c3a91e679abf649b9a19449d4d46c743d97ea2273d840118f82bc840be2020:0
- value
- 2426296
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4e2f40efb9b9d6e2bf6a38cca33201d89498e11 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PKqkoXCd7guUAYiU8S12jRY5KGdSH485P